Why Does My Cat Have Small Bald Spots. Many different health conditions can cause hair loss, so it’s important to have your cat examined by a veterinarian if you notice unusual patches, bald spots, or extreme thinning of the hair coat. One of the most common reasons for a cat to develop a random bald spot is stress or anxiety. The first thing to do is identify whether it is a pathological hair loss.
